Aunt Grace'S Salad Dressing

Prep: 5 min Cuisine: American

A quick and easy salad dressing with a tangy, sweet, and savory flavor profile, perfect for enhancing greens and vegetables, suitable for casual and family meals.

Be the first to rate this recipe

Ingredients

  • 1 medium onion
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on pepper
  • 1 teaspoon celery seed
  • 1 tablespoon prepared mustard
  • 1/3 cup vinegar
  • 2/3 cup sugar
  • 1 cup oil or less

Instructions

  1. Whirl all ingredients in a blender for 1 minute.
  2. Store in the refrigerator.
  3. Quick, easy, and delicious!

Tips & Substitutions

For a smoother dressing, blend the ingredients for an extra 30 seconds. You can substitute apple cider vinegar for the vinegar for a slightly sweeter flavor. If you prefer a less oily dressing, start with 1/2 cup of oil and adjust to taste. This dressing works wonderfully with salads featuring hearty greens, or even as a marinade for chicken or fish.

Storage & Reheating

Store the dressing in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to two weeks. Shake or stir well before using, as separation may occur. Avoid freezing, as the texture may change upon thawing. It’s perfect for quick salads throughout the week or as a flavorful drizzle for sandwiches.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I make this dressing in advance?

Yes, this dressing can be made ahead of time and stored in the refrigerator. In fact, letting it sit for a day allows the flavors to meld beautifully, enhancing its taste. Just give it a good shake before using, as the ingredients may separate.

Is this dressing suitable for vegan diets?

Yes, this dressing is vegan-friendly since it contains no animal products. It's a great option for those looking for flavorful vegan recipes. Feel free to adjust the ingredients to your preference, perhaps using a vegan mustard if desired.
